export const webext = self.browser;
/******************************************************************************/
// https://developer.mozilla.org/docs/Mozilla/Add-ons/WebExtensions/API/declarativeNetRequest/
const nativeDNR = webext.declarativeNetRequest;
const isSupportedRule = r => {
if ( r.action.responseHeaders ) { return false; }
const { condition } = r;
if ( condition.tabIds !== undefined ) { return false; }
if ( condition.resourceTypes?.includes('object') ) {
if ( condition.resourceTypes.length === 1 ) { return false; }
const i = condition.resourceTypes.indexOf('object');
condition.resourceTypes.splice(i, 1);
}
if ( condition.excludedResourceTypes?.includes('object') ) {
const i = condition.excludedResourceTypes.indexOf('object');
condition.excludedResourceTypes.splice(i, 1);
if ( condition.excludedResourceTypes.length === 0 ) {
delete condition.excludedResourceTypes;
}
}
return true;
};
const prepareUpdateRules = optionsBefore => {
const { addRules, removeRuleIds } = optionsBefore;
const addRulesAfter = addRules?.filter(isSupportedRule);
if ( Boolean(addRulesAfter?.length || removeRuleIds?.length) === false ) { return; }
addRulesAfter?.forEach(r => {
if ( r.action?.redirect?.regexSubstitution ) {
if ( r.condition?.requestDomains ) {
r.condition.domains = r.condition.requestDomains;
delete r.condition.requestDomains;
return;
}
}
if ( r.condition?.initiatorDomains ) {
r.condition.domains = r.condition.initiatorDomains;
delete r.condition.initiatorDomains;
}
if ( r.condition?.excludedInitiatorDomains ) {
r.condition.excludedDomains = r.condition.excludedInitiatorDomains;
delete r.condition.excludedInitiatorDomains;
}
});
const optionsAfter = {};
if ( addRulesAfter?.length ) { optionsAfter.addRules = addRulesAfter; }
if ( removeRuleIds?.length ) { optionsAfter.removeRuleIds = removeRuleIds; }
return optionsAfter;
};
const ruleCompare = (a, b) => a.id - b.id;
const isSameRules = (a, b) => {
a.sort(ruleCompare);
b.sort(ruleCompare);
return JSON.stringify(a) === JSON.stringify(b);
};
/******************************************************************************/
export function normalizeDNRRules(rules, ruleIds) {
if ( Array.isArray(rules) === false ) { return rules; }
const selectedRules = Array.isArray(ruleIds)
? rules.filter(rule => ruleIds.includes(rule.id))
: rules;
selectedRules.forEach(rule => {
const { condition } = rule;
if ( Array.isArray(condition.domains) ) {
condition.initiatorDomains = condition.domains;
delete condition.domains;
}
if ( Array.isArray(condition.excludedDomains) ) {
condition.excludedInitiatorDomains = condition.excludedDomains;
delete condition.excludedDomains;
}
});
return selectedRules;
}
